Structure101 free download for Mac


17 April 2012

Control software architecture and limit complexity (beta).


Structure101 makes software structure (design, architecture and packaging) easy to understand, define, control and keep simple.

The first thing structure101 does is simply to let you understand the structure of your code-base from different perspectives.

You can define how the code should be structured - the architecture - in such a way that your entire team can easily understand it, move the structure towards it, and keep it so.

You can assign limits to the structural complexity and structure101 will measure the code at every level and highlight the regions that are excessively complex.

Most critically, structure101 tells you how your structure has changed from a reference structure - for example, what are the new dependencies, new architecture violations, complexity trends? This means you don't need to review everything all the time - just keep an eye on how it's evolving.

What's new in Structure101

Version 3.5.1727:

General changes:

  • ENG-511 Fix: Performance problems in architecture perspective with many modules.
  • ENG-506 Fix: Keyboard shortcuts.
  • ENG-505 Fix: OS X.
  • ENG-498 Fix: Concurrent Exception and NPE in diagrams.
  • ENG-496 New icons.
  • ENG-495 Fix: Wizard is topped on MAC.
Java-specific changes:
  • ENG-513 Fix: Missing methods not shown.
  • ENG-509 Fix: Notables broke on Jar breakout.
  • ENG-425 New: Omit deprecated code from the model.

0 Structure101 Reviews

Rate this app:



App requirements: 
  • Intel 64
  • Intel 32
  • PPC 64
  • PPC 32
  • Mac OS X 10.3.9 or later
Developer Website: 
Download(18.2 MB)MacUpdateInstall with MacUpdate

Downloaded & Installed 3,518 times